METHOD Fold recognition was performed using the Target98 (SAM-T98) method 
METHOD [3] using SAM version 2.1.1 [1], a refinement of the methods developed 
METHOD by this group for CASP2 [2].  This method attempts to find and multiply  
METHOD align a set of homologs to a given sequence, then create an HMM from that  
METHOD multiple alignment. 
METHOD  
METHOD First, a set of sequence weights is determined from the alignment.  Next,  
METHOD Modelfromalign is used to build the model from the alignment and the  
METHOD sequence weights.  Finally, hmmscore performs a local, all-paths scoring  
METHOD of the sequences, using a reversed-sequence normalization feature. 
METHOD  
METHOD The weighting method, detailed in upcoming publications [3,4], 
METHOD combines the Henikoffs' scheme [5], Dirichlet mixtures [6], and an 
METHOD entropy method to set the final weights.

METHOD Alignment generation 
METHOD  
METHOD The initial step uses BLASTP to search NRP twice: once to produce a set 
METHOD of very close homologs, and once to produce a set of possible homologs. 
METHOD  
METHOD The method then uses multiple iterations of a selection, training, and  
METHOD alignment procedure.  Each iteration involves an initial alignment, a set  
METHOD of search sequences, a threshold value, and a transition regularizer.  
METHOD  
METHOD The first iteration uses a single sequence (or seed alignment) as the  
METHOD initial alignment and the close homologs found by BLASTP are used as the  
METHOD search set.  The threshold is set very strictly, so that only good matches  
METHOD to the sequence are considered.  This iteration uses a transition regularizer  
METHOD that was designed to match the gap costs used by BLASTP. 
METHOD  
METHOD On subsequent iterations the input alignment is the output from the 
METHOD previous iteration, the search set is the larger set of possible 
METHOD homologs found by BLASTP, and the thresholds are gradually loosened. 
METHOD The second through second-from-last iteration use a ``long-match'' 
METHOD transition regularizer, and the final iteration uses a transition regularizer  
METHOD trained on FSSP alignments.

METHOD Since we had a good hit to the beginning of T0064 for a DNA-binding 
METHOD site, we conjectured that the last 40 residues of T0064 (t64tail) were 
METHOD interacting with T0065.  Since we had no strong hits with either 
METHOD t64tail or T0065, we created a chimeric sequence by concatenating 
METHOD t64tail and T0065.  This got us a fairly strong hit to 1ois. 
METHOD  
METHOD We noted the separation between the sequences in the best alignment (7 
METHOD residues), and created a new chimeric sequence: t64tail+7X+T0065. 
METHOD This produced excellent hits with 1ois---strong enough that even the 
METHOD wu-blast score was in a range with only 25% false positives.  Our 
METHOD score summing both ways was -16.6---in a range where fewer than 5% of 
METHOD the hits are false positives in out tests (the score is probably a bit 
METHOD optimistic---there should be a 2-3 nat penalty for the different 
METHOD possible insertion lenghts between the chains).  Interestingly, the 
METHOD 1ois structure has a break in the chain right at the place where we 
METHOD were predicting the transition from T0064 to T0065, so the structure 
METHOD probably does not rely on a continuous chain there. 
METHOD  
METHOD We then tried aligning T0064+7X+T0065 to 1adr (predicted for the first 
METHOD part of T0064) and 1ois.  The score for 1ois was not as strong as 
METHOD before (-7.7, in a range where 70% are false positives), but better 
METHOD than anything found for T0065 alone.  With some hand-tweaking, we got 
METHOD complete coverage of the target with very few insertions or deletions. 
METHOD The helix that ends 1adr can be continued as the helix in 1ois---it 
METHOD even looks like the domains avoid bumping into each other with this 
METHOD alignment.
